LEE COUNTY, Fla. – Two women were found beaten to death in bushes behind a Bonita Bay home in December 2020.
In a newly released case file, Lee County detectives confirm two women with severe facial trauma were beaten inside the home, moved outside, thrown into bushes behind the home’s pool, then covered with white towels.
The homeowner, Dorothy Breen, was one of the victims.
Investigators believe Terry Cunningham killed the women, then killed himself.
Cunningham allegedly cleaned the house after killing the women, drove to his condo, went back to Breen’s home, called 911 to report the deaths, then shot himself with a shotgun.
The motive of the double-murder is unknown.
